Transporeon
We will present the results of a recent carrier survey conducted by Transporeon. More than 1,000 road carriers of all sizes from all industries and from across Europe answered survey questions on these and several other key topics:
Carrier expectations about current business conditions and revenue development
Transport prices and capacities through 2017 and 2018
The preferred proportion of fixed-contract orders and daily spot market allocation

Supply Chain Planning teams are operating in a world where disruptions are happening more frequently and they have become predictably unpredictable, and bigger in impact. The supply chain planning organizations have the responsibility to lead their organizations’ planning for future demand and supply. In a volatile environment this is becoming increasingly difficult, and more often than not, the businesses end up finding themselves in a highly reactive mode of operations. The organization structures, processes and technologies of the past have a hard time keeping up with today’s challenges.

In this insightful Webinar, Resolve will showcase how it assisted Pick n Pay to improve on-time, in-full delivery performance with the help of its technology partner, One Network. You will gain insight into how Pick n Pay manages its central distribution system, how a logistics control tower was implemented and adopted, as well as the partnership between One Network, Pick n Pay and Resolve on the continued control tower journey for Pick n Pay.
